About the Role
Our vision is to transform how the world uses information to enrich life for all. Micron Technology is a world leader in innovating memory and storage solutions that accelerate the transformation of information into intelligence, inspiring the world to learn, communicate and advance faster than ever. As a Sr Category Supplier Manager for the Tool Install category at Micron, you will be at the forefront of driving excellence within our procurement strategies. This is an outstanding opportunity to collaborate with world-class professionals and determine innovative solutions that strictly adhere to our ambitious goals!
Responsibilities
- Develop and successfully implement processes to monitor collaborator happiness with key suppliers, and recommend value-maximizing targets such as revenue growth and spend reduction
- Assist in supplier segmentation and strategic goal setting by developing category strategies for managed categories
- Identify and evaluate category-specific savings/revenue levers, driving category savings/revenue and scorecard metric targets
- Share market insights and category price trends with internal collaborators, using should-cost models for designated categories that are benchmarked and relevant to the global market
- Lead or participate in negotiations for contract extensions and renewals, renegotiation of prices, transfers, etc., and lead sourcing events/RFQ process into bundled negotiation
- Develop supplier contract strategies for assigned categories by incorporating cost savings, negotiating contracts, sourcing, and evaluating suppliers
- Collaborate with key customers to deliver strategic solutions by developing and maintaining expertise in assigned spend categories through positive relationship management
- Drive a customer-centric approach to issue resolution and Procurement representation by developing collaborative partnerships that improve cost-effectiveness, supply chain efficiency, and resilience
Minimum Qualifications
- Over 10 years of experience in the Construction / Tool Install Category
- A relevant b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
- Proven experience in category management and strategic sourcing
- Effective communication, negotiation, and analytical skills
- Advanced skills in material cost structure understanding and analysis
Preferred Qualifications
- A decade of experience within the Construction / Tool Install Category
- Prior experience working in indirect category management at a semiconductor company
- Experience working with Ariba, SAP, and SCOUT
